What is an array in multiplication?

Back

An array is a visual representation of multiplication, showing groups of equal size. For example, a 3x4 array has 3 rows of 4 items each.

What does the multiplication equation 3x3 represent?

Back

It represents an array with 3 rows and 3 columns, totaling 9 items.

What is the division equation for an array with 20 items in 5 equal groups?

Back

20 ÷ 5 = 4, meaning there are 4 items in each group.

How can you model the equation 12 ÷ 4?

Back

You can model it with an array that has 4 rows with 3 items in each row.

What does the equation 8 ÷ 4 = 2 mean?

Back

It means that when you divide 8 items into 4 equal groups, each group has 2 items.

How do you find the total number of items in a 5x5 array?

Back

You multiply the number of rows by the number of columns: 5 x 5 = 25.
